Fórum Ubuntu CZ/SK
Ostatní => Ubuntu Server => Téma založeno: veronika 12 Května 2010, 21:35:40
-
ahojky, můžu dotázek? dostali jsme od o2 pevnou veřejnou IP a tak bychom chtěli náš panelákovej apache zpřístupnit i z internetu. Jestli dobře chápu výklad našeho ICT kantora, tak v etc/network/interfaces nastavím tu fixní IP + masku 255.255.255.0. Ale prý se ještě v etc/hosts musí nastavit nejen tahle adresa, ale ještě nějakej název domény...... co se tam má dát? Ještě se pak někde musí něco udělat? Musím si registrovat taky tu doménu?
Moc se omlouvám za lama dotazy, jsem spíš uživatelka..... :-\
-
pro nastavení sítě stačí správně nastavit jen interfaces :) jinak název domény = jméno počítače..to je spíše pro interní služby, k běhu na netu to není imho nezbytně nutné...
Jinak pokud chceš na serveru provozovat web, tak doménu bys měla mít registrovanou..aby se tam dalo dostat, že jo..
-
Myslela jsem že by se tam dalo dostat přímo zadáním té IP, ono to bude sloužit zase jen uzavřené skupince lidí jako dosud, akorát že se tam půjde dostat třeba ze školy. Ale to nevadí, už jsem si na forpsi vyplnila formulář na doménu a dneska jim pošlu prachy.
Takže ta doména - třeba doména.cz - musí fakt být název toho poče? Třeba ve škole máme v síti názvy zak01, ucitel atd. a přitom na internetu je jenom jedna adresa na stránky školy. A v terminálu mám taky třeba veronika.n@zak05 a ne @www.skola.....
-
Ja mám internet od o2 žádnou veřejnou adresu sem neobědnával ale čet sem že sou automaticky,pevnou asi nemám ale tady na vesnici mi to stejně změní adresu jednou za rok a modem nevypínám :) stačilo mi nainstalovat apache třeba podle tohoto návodu
http://www.howtoforge.com/ubuntu_lamp_for_newbies
povolit port 80
napojený na modem mám 1pc-win,2pc-ubuntu,ps3,iphone ale žádnej portforwarding sem nastavovat nemusel automaticky mi to našlo server na ubuntu
jít na http://www.anonymouse.org a zadat ip routeru tu zjistíš tady
http://www.mojeip.cz/
a sem tam nic víc nic mín :) a kdokoliv se napojí když dá do url tvoji IP a doménu mít nemusíš,ale občas se nevyplatí dávat ip někomu kdo neni lama kor když nemáš zabezpečenej systém :)
-
V interfaces na vnější rozhraní fixní IP + odpovídajíí masku, tu vám také sdělí provider - ta může být jiná než ta /24 co uvádíte.
Přistupovat můžete přes IP i bez placení za doménu, jen je to méně pohodlné.
Dokonce pokud si uděláte ručně záznamy v hosts souborech počítačů (umí win i lin) které budou chtít na ten apache přistupovat tak můžete přistupovat i nějakým jménem (případně jmény a na apache může běžet na té jedné IP více webů pod různými názvy)
Ne doména nemusí být název serveru. Stačí v nastavení apache a k tomu na klientech buď ruční zápis v hosts, nebo doména s A záznamem ukazujícím na IP serveru.
Zagooglete Apache virtual host
A pokud už doménu koupenou máte a registrátor chce platit za správu dns záznamů tak existují veřejné dns zdarma (osobně používám gratisdns.dk z důvodu plné podpory všech typů záznamů vč. plné podpory IPv6 protokolu).
-
Ten hosts mám takhle a tohle nevím:
127.0.0.1 localhost
moje IP od O2 co dát sem za název??
# The following lines are desirable for IPv6 capable hosts
::1 localhost 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
Ten název se potom bude někde zobrazovat? Nebo to je potom jedno jestli dám do adresy tu IP nebo název?
Ještě mě zaujalo těch víc webů v tom hosts, to by nemělo chybu..... akorát to moc nechápu, myslela jsem že ty weby odliším adresářema ve kterých jsou (http//ip servru/www xyz)..... když tam dám na tu samou IP víc názvů jak to ten apache pozná co má zobrazit? Fakt sorry za lamí dotazy, ale tohle nějak nepobírám..... dík :-[
-
Ten hosts mám takhle a tohle nevím:
127.0.0.1 localhost
moje IP od O2 co dát sem za název??
# The following lines are desirable for IPv6 capable hosts
::1 localhost 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
Ten název se potom bude někde zobrazovat? Nebo to je potom jedno jestli dám do adresy tu IP nebo název?
Ještě mě zaujalo těch víc webů v tom hosts, to by nemělo chybu..... akorát to moc nechápu, myslela jsem že ty weby odliším adresářema ve kterých jsou (http//ip servru/www xyz)..... když tam dám na tu samou IP víc názvů jak to ten apache pozná co má zobrazit? Fakt sorry za lamí dotazy, ale tohle nějak nepobírám..... dík :-[
mělo by to vypadat nějak takhle
127.0.0.1 localhost.localdomain localhost
192.168.0.1 server.mojedomena.tld server
# The following lines are desirable for IPv6 capable hosts
::1 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
ff02::3 ip6-allhosts
zkus ještě kouknout na
http://profiweb.net/blog/jak-na-linuxovy-server-kompletni-navod-krok-za-krokem.a73.html
-
/etc/hosts
funguje pouze pokud zadáváte doménové jméno (třeba do prohlížeče) přímo na stroji kde je příslušný /etc/hosts. Jednoduše jde o to že se systém nezeptá DNS serveru ale koukne nejdříve do /etc/hosts tam záznam najde tak nic neřeší a jde přímo na vypsanou adresu. (pokud nenajde ptá se DNS serveru)
Tedy pokud by jste toto chtěli řešit takhle tak na každém PC z kterého chcete přstupovat (Linux i Win -> /windows/system32/drivers/etc/hosts pro 64bit W7 je jiná složka) musíte nastavit tento soubor. Takže nejlepším řešením je u registrátora domény si nastavte DNS A záznam na "moje IP od O2" A kdykoliv se někdo z internetu zeptá na danou doménu tak DNS už řekne na kterou IP má jít a máte to nastavený globálně a nemusíte se hrabat v každém PC ve škole.
EDIT: ještě doporučuji na zapamatování jednu maličkost. ISP může veřejnou IP adresu změnit takže pokud dojde k výpadku tak to může být způsobeno i tímto. Osobně se mi to stalo s O2 a UPC
-
když tam dám na tu samou IP víc názvů jak to ten apache pozná co má zobrazit? Fakt sorry za lamí dotazy, ale tohle nějak nepobírám..... dík :-[
Pozná to podle http hlavičky ve které je ten název, ale opakuji se - Zagooglete Apache virtual host
Musím letět, na případné dotazy odpovím nejdříve pozdě večer.